Air Sénégal Flight Makes Emergency Landing in Morocco for Medical Crisis

Tuesday 20 December 2022, by Sylvanus

Air Sénégal airline cites the reasons behind the emergency landing of one of its planes from Paris to Dakar in Agadir.

In a statement signed by its CEO, Air Sénégal indicates that flight HC4040 from Paris to Dakar on December 18, 2022 was forced to land in Agadir for a medical emergency of a passenger on board. "As Agadir is not a destination served" by the company, "there were therefore operational constraints," adds the same source, assuring that once these constraints were lifted, "the passengers were finally transported to their destination under good conditions."

Air Sénégal also presented its "sincere apologies to all its passengers for the inconvenience suffered."
